Listening to the Future: Why Renewable Energy Podcasts Should Be on Your Radar

Posted on May 12, 2025 By Dante No Comments on Listening to the Future: Why Renewable Energy Podcasts Should Be on Your Radar

Lately, I’ve found myself diving headfirst into the world of renewable energy—not by scrolling through dense articles or technical reports, but through podcasts. There’s something about hearing passionate voices discuss solar, wind, and other green technologies that makes the subject less intimidating and a lot more exciting.

Renewable energy podcasts have this rare ability to blend education with storytelling, making complex topics accessible no matter your background. Whether you’re a curious beginner or someone already knee-deep in sustainability work, these podcasts offer fresh perspectives and inspired ideas.

One of the coolest things about tuning into these shows is getting a front-row seat to the rapid changes shaping our planet. From interviews with innovators designing next-gen batteries to grassroots activists pushing for policy shifts, the content feels alive and urgent. It’s a reminder that renewable energy isn’t just about science—it’s about people, communities, and a shared vision for a cleaner future.

Also, let’s be honest, these podcasts add a spark to your daily routine. Commuting? A renewable energy podcast can turn that time into an opportunity to learn about innovations like floating wind farms or the challenges of integrating solar power into existing grids. Walking the dog? Now you’re also getting smarter about why renewable energy matters beyond the headlines.

Starting with shows like “The Energy Transition Show” or “Sustainababble” can give you a good mix of detailed discussions and approachable humor. As you listen more, you might discover episodes that dive into topics you never expected to care about but suddenly find fascinating—say, the environmental impact of cobalt mining or how blockchain technology fits into clean energy trading.

Beyond just education, these podcasts often act as a community—that sense of connection is powerful. Many have accompanying social media groups or listener forums where people share thoughts, tips, and sometimes frustrations about the slow pace of change. It’s a reminder we’re not alone in wanting to rethink how we power our lives.

If you haven’t given renewable energy podcasts a try yet, it’s worth plugging in your headphones. You’ll likely walk away with not just new knowledge but renewed hope and motivation to be part of the solution. And honestly, in a world that can feel overwhelming, having a friendly voice guide you through the possibilities of clean energy feels like a real gift.
